The BBB and BCSFB are formed by tight junctions of brain capillary endothelial cells and choroid plexus epithelial cells, respectively, and serve to regulate the supply of essential nutrients into the brain/CSF and the elimination of xenobiotics and endogenous metabolites from the brain/CSF via various transport systems such as transporters [5, 6]

B12 deficiency can start to be an issue in lambs after about three to four weeks of age, when the reserves from the ewe have depleted and the lambs are beginning to graze more
